ssb TIGR00621
single stranded DNA-binding protein (ssb); All proteins in this family for which functions are ...
8-87 3.03e-04

single stranded DNA-binding protein (ssb); All proteins in this family for which functions are known are single-stranded DNA binding proteins that function in many processes including transcription, repair, replication and recombination. Members encoded between genes for ribosomal proteins S6 and S18 should be annotated as primosomal protein N (PriB). Forms in gamma-protoeobacteria are much shorter and poorly recognized by this model. Additional members of this family include phage proteins. Eukaryotic members are organellar proteins. [DNA metabolism, DNA replication, recombination, and repair]
